> Put a domain.tld so SA can query an NS record. Unless you actualy have an 
> NS record for localhost, your existing configuration is invalid. (And 
> please read that carefully, I said an NS record, as in a record for the 
> domain localhost, not that localhost runs a nameserver)
> 
> You also left off the end..
> 
> "Please note, the DNS test queries for NS records. "
> 
> 
> You can't do an NS record query on anything but a domain name.. ie: there 
> is no ns record for xanadu.evi-inc.com or 208.39.141.94, but there is an NS 
> record for evi-inc.com. The reason being xanadu is a host, not a domain.
